Vintage Livestock Market July 12 & 13,1999 Report Supplied By PDA CATTLE CALVES SHEEP GOATS TUESDAY 905 HOGS 13 241 7 LAST WEEK 3 4 LAST YEAR 0 0 670 CATTLE - Compared to Thursday, slaughter steers and heifers sold 50 to I 00 higher. Trading was active and demand was on the increase for the first time in several weeks. Holstein steers sold steady to .50 higher. The slaughter cows sold mostly steady with Thursday's active market and slaughter bulls traded 1 00 lower Supply included 49 pet slaughter steers and 42 pet cows. Compared to last week, there was an unusually large number of calves on hand Vealers traded as much as 10 00 higher, but orders were mostly filled by the time the graded calves sold. Holstein bulls sold firm to 15 00 higher with several local farmer feeders in the market Trading was active, but buyers were very particular as to weight Holstein heifers sold mostly 20 00 lower Supply included 759 head in the Stale graded sale and 80 percent returned to feed VEALERS Good and Choice 70-110 lbs 20 00-37 00 Standard and low Good 60-90 lbs 10 00-27 00 RETURNED TO FARM Holstein bulls 100-125 lbs 127 00-133 00. 90-100 lbs 80 00- 102 00 Plamcr-type bulls 90-115 lbs 40 00-85 00. weaker calves down to .3000 Holstein heifers 85-115 lbs 220 00-257 00 Plainer heifers 85-110 lbs 197 00-230 00. 65-85 lbs 60 GO -127 00 Beef-type bulls and heifers 80-110 lbs 60 00-105 00.
